Можно ли подключить LED Matrix-Dual Color-Small напрямую с контролером Arduino Uno, без использования платы расширения Uno Proto Shield. Если да, то покажите схему.
Привет!
Подключить эту матрицу напрямую к выходам Arduino UNO не получится. Дело в том, что матрица состоит из 8х8х2=128 светодиодов, а у Arduino UNO всего 14 цифровых выходов. Поэтому для управления светодиодами матрицы следует использовать дополнительную микросхему(ы). Пример подключения можно найти в статье на сайте tronixstuff.
И еще... У матрицы 24 пина, но все примеры и инструкции которые нашла в интернете, сделаны с использованием матрицы с 16 пин. Как мне подстроиться под эти несоответствия. Более того, мне не нужно два цвет, достаточно одного - зеленого
А вам не подойдет более умнаяматрица как в нашем проекте "Умный цветок"? Для неё ничего дополнительно не нужно потому, что он управляется через интерфейс SPI.
Скажу что мне надо: Пишу курсовую на тему" технологии разработки программного обеспечения". Нужна обычная программа. Я хочу запрограммировать бегущую строку на вот этой вот матрице, и описать все по ГОСТ-у. Естественно все должно работать безупречно. Мои попытки подобрать что-то к чему-то потерпели провал. На данный момент в наличие:
1)Arduino uno rev
2)Соединительные провода для Arduino
3)Mini bread board seflf adhezive
4) Светодиодная матрица [com-00681]
По плану нужна плата расширения, но чувствую что все идет не так, и плата не поможет.
Ыыы, Help?
Теперь понятно. Тогда вам нужно 8 модулей Shiftout Module. В них есть сдвиговые регистры 74HC595, к выходам которых надо будет подключить через токоограничивающие резисторы светодиоды вашей матрицы. Регистры нужно соединить каскадно чтобы получилось 64 разряда - по одному разряду на светодиод.
Спасибо за объяснения. Попробую разобраться что к чему. Все кажется довольно сложным. Тут больше электроники чем программирования. Надеюсь вопросов больше не появятся, хотя сильно в этом сомневаюсь.
Насколько я понимаю, использование макетной платы Bread Board дает нам возможность не использовать паяльник. Значит под Bread Board нужна другая плата?
По ссылке которой вы мне прислали описывается способ соединения с матрицей с 16 пин. Значит моя с 24 пин не подойдет?